Simplify Volt RoboCar Disruption and Tech ETF (NYSEARCA:VCAR) Stock Price Up 1.1%

Simplify Volt RoboCar Disruption and Tech ETF (NYSEARCA:VCARGet Free Report) shares rose 1.1% during mid-day trading on Tuesday . The company traded as high as $12.22 and last traded at $12.22. Approximately 1,533 shares changed hands during mid-day trading, a decline of 58% from the average daily volume of 3,653 shares. The stock had previously closed at $12.08.

Simplify Volt RoboCar Disruption and Tech ETF Company Profile

The Simplify Volt RoboCar Disruption and Tech ETF (VCAR) is an exchange-traded fund that mostly invests in stocks based on a particular theme. The fund actively selects a narrow portfolio of companies globally that focus on autonomous driving. The fund may use options to leverage performance. VCAR was launched on Dec 28, 2020 and is managed by Simplify.
